Plot
A onehour dramatic film which explores the cultural social and political fabrics between two gay Chinese men living under parallel traditions within the Chinese social structure Through the unfolding of events following the 1989 Tien An Men Square Massacre in Beijing the film focuses on Paul a young ChineseCanadian artist and Kai a foreign student in exile from mainland China as they confront the differences in their politics sexuality cultural upbringing and family relationships As they are drawn closer together it becomes obvious that for the many displaced Chinese around the world there lies ahead a long arduous journey towards a questionable future
